## Who to ping about GiftNote

Welcome aboard! GiftNote is our donation-receipt mailer for the Larchfield Fund. Template tweaks go to the comms folks; delivery failures and bounce weirdness go to the platform crew. Don't push template changes on Fridays — receipts batch over the weekend. For anything GiftNote-related, start with the address below.

billing contact of kaweg-tajeg = drudor.lamion.oliath@torvalabs.test

Postmortem timeline — Cartwheel POS barcode scanner outage, entry 3. Around 14:20 the Lumen handheld scanners started returning truncated EANs, so checkout lanes at the Drayton pilot store fell back to manual entry. Turns out the vendor firmware update changed the frame delimiter, and our parser happily ate half the digits. We shipped a tolerant-parsing hotfix at 15:05 and confirmed clean scans by 15:12. Support folks: any tickets from that window can be closed as resolved. The hotfix's trace token is recorded just below.

trace token, fafog-kageg: htk4_98e6

## Who to contact: string-extract.py

The translation-string extraction script (`string-extract.py` in the Lanternmoss repo) is owned by the Localization Platform pod. It runs nightly, scans templates for `t()` calls, and pushes candidate strings to the Phrasewell queue for translator review. If the nightly job fails, check the parser version pin first — mismatches with the template compiler are the usual cause. For escalations, extraction rule changes, or to add a new source directory, email the pod at the address below.

alerts address for bajop-yahog: istwyn@lumiclabs.internal

Welcome to the Quillbrook platform team. Your first task touches the websocket reconnect bug in the Fennelgate client: after a dropped connection, the backoff timer resets incorrectly and floods the broker. Reproduce it locally with the stub broker before changing anything. To decrypt the captured session traces in the contractor sandbox, use the passphrase that appears on the next line.

vault phrase of bagaf-kajeg = jorath-feniel-briir-siliel-ralix